Binary package hint: gtk2-engines

Upon performing and aptitude dist-upgrade I am unable to get gtk2-engines to install for edgy eft.

The issue even when attempted to be fixed by aptitude -f install fails to go away, and the error is shown below:

Need to get 0B/343kB of archives.
After unpacking 926kB of additional disk space will be used.
Do you want to continue [Y/n]? Y
(Reading database ... 76112 files and directories currently installed.)
Unpacking gtk2-engines (from .../gtk2-engines_1%3a2.8.0-0ubuntu1_amd64.deb) ...
dpkg: error processing /var/cache/apt/archives/gtk2-engines_1%3a2.8.0-0ubuntu1_amd64.deb (--unpack):
 trying to overwrite `/usr/share/themes/Clearlooks/gtk-2.0/gtkrc', which is also in package gtk2-engines-clearlooks
Errors were encountered while processing:
 /var/cache/apt/archives/gtk2-engines_1%3a2.8.0-0ubuntu1_amd64.deb
E: Sub-process /usr/bin/dpkg returned an error code (1)

From here it seems simply that the two packages are conflicting over the one file.
